This thread is long since zombied, but, inspired by Big_wasa, I'm doing a full strip of my ST170 loom, and rebuild it 'lighter'.
I was fortunate enough to start from a full MOT'd car, so I shouldn't be missing anything. I did sell the console with the clock and hence my immobiliser-armed LED, but that should be a 50c replacement.
All Ford interconnects (unions that join wire to another wire, or go through bulkheads etc) have been cut out, leaving only connector to connector links).
I'm doing up a big spreadsheet of every connector I need (I'll caveat this; I'mbuilding a MEV Rocket, so no doors, alarm, AC, power steering etc), what colour the stock wires are, and what pin on what connector/fuse/relay they go to. There's a tab for the Fuses and relays too.
Initially I'm doing track-only, so v1 won't have lights, horn etc.
Should be finished the theory part in about a week or two, and I've wired up about 20% of the connectors for real in the garage. Probably a couple of months till turn over, it's a one-day-a-weekend project.

Absolutely wouldn't be possible (for me) without the Ford wiring diagram, and I use the connector and component references from it throughout. Probably going to need it to use my guide.

Evap codes question

Hi, all

First time here and I really hope someone can help me with a nagging problem i have.

I live in the states and I have a Caterham with an '04 SVT motor and I need to get it through emissions here in Georgia. Emissions here doesn't actually mean what comes out the exhaust, it means they plug a reader into the OBD port and fail it if any codes exist, whether or not they're related to exhaust gas! It's strange, but i'm stuck with it.

My problem is that my car has codes p0453 and p1451 permanently in the system due to how the wiring and/or switches were modified for this car, but i see from reading this thread that it's possible to install a resistor to perhaps tell the ECU (pin 56 perhaps?) that all is well with the tank pressure and stop the codes reappearing.

The other requirement from the man is i have to have MIL on the dash. I can't see from the diagram which pin relates to the MIL. I think it's pin 2 from what else I've read, but I wonder if anyone can help me figure the above out? If so, does this pin switch to ground or + voltage when a code is present?

I've called mechanics and garages and most won't go near this car because it's weird. The car's also a pain to start, but that's my next challenge for when I can get it roadworthy
